Taxonomy
Folliceps was named by Opik (1970) [Sepkoski's age data: Cm uMid Sepkoski's reference number: 16]. It is not extant.
It was assigned to Trilobita by Sepkoski (2002); and to Nepeidae by Jell and Adrain (2002).
